About this programme
Data Science is at the heart of decision making and customer treatments at Sky. We provide analytics to inform customer growth strategies, create tooling to drive personalised customer treatments, and champion test-and-learn through experimentation.
You’ll learn from the best in the industry and get support in bringing your ideas to life. Impress us, and we may offer you a full-time position on a graduate programme once you graduate.
What you’ll be doing
On our Data Science internship, you’ll have exposure across the business as you work with stakeholders to help drive decision making using the power of data and insights. You’ll learn analytical techniques and use cutting-edge predictive algorithms to deliver valuable insight to the business. You could be helping to build our next data product, predicting future customer behaviour, or unlocking the value of our content.
You’ll get exposure to one of our Data Science teams in Sky Data:
-
Data Science & Analytics – Consumer – Work closely with commercial teams, building data science models and data products to help inform and drive strategic decisions
-
Data Science & Analytics – Content – Work with viewing data to build personalised customer experiences and help customers discover more of what they love
-
Data Science & Analytics – Product & Operations – Work with product teams to build new data tools and improve the effectiveness and performance of the products our customers use every day
What we’re looking for
You’re a graduate from any degree discipline, or will soon be. You may have studied maths, statistics, computer science, economics, or physics, or be able to demonstrate your understanding of data through personal or university projects. What matters most is your passion for data and the drive and ambition you can bring to the team.
Other skills we value include:
-
Logical, end-to-end thinker
-
Enthusiastic problem-solver with numerical, presentation, and IT skills
-
Previous experience in data manipulation using Python, SQL, R, SAS, MATLAB
-
Academic experience in machine learning, including supervised/unsupervised learning, regression, decision trees, random forests, and boosting
-
Enjoy task-focused delivery, fast-paced environments, and overcoming challenges
-
Collaborative, great with people, and keen on following recent trends in the market
